Misted Window Repair Kit: A Comprehensive Guide
Windows are vital elements of any home, supplying needed light and views while contributing to insulation and security. However, over time, certain weather and use and tear can result in issues, most notably misted windows. Misted windows happen when the insulating seal between glass panes in double- or triple-glazed windows fails, allowing moisture to enter and develop condensation. Understanding the Misted Window Problem
Before diving into repair solutions, let's analyze why windows mist and the implications of this issue.
Reasons For Misted WindowsTriggerDescriptionSeal FailureMoisture breaches the seal in between the glass panes.Poor InstallationInaccurate fitting of windows can lead to seal degradation.AgeOlder windows are more prone to seal failure.Extreme WeatherTemperature level changes can worry the Glass Condensation Repair and seals.Implications of Misted Windows
Misted windows not only block your view however can likewise result in more significant problems, including:
Loss of energy efficiencyIncreased energy costsProspective mold growth in between panesDecreased property worthWhat is a Misted Window Repair Kit?

Preventing misted windows is constantly better than repairing them. Here are effective techniques to keep your windows in optimal conditions:
Regular Maintenance: Schedule routine assessments of your window seals.Preserve Ideal Indoor Humidity: Use dehumidifiers if needed to keep humidity levels below 60%.Choose Quality Windows: Investing in high-quality windows will pay off in the long run, offered their sturdiness.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Can I repair misted windows, or do I require to change the entire window?
While some mild misting can be repaired with a misted window repair kit, if the damage is substantial or the windows are old, a total replacement might be more cost-effective in the long run.
Q2: How do I know if my sealed window is actually harmed?
If you observe consistent fogging between the glass panes, spots, or any noticeable moisture, it indicates a failed seal that might require attention.
Q3: How long will it take for the moisture to be totally absorbed?
Depending upon the level of condensation, the moisture can take a couple of hours to a couple of days to be fully taken in utilizing an absorbent sponge.
